The NWAACC released the Softball and Baseball Coaches Polls on Wednewsday, April 28, 2010.  The coaches from the NWAACC vote on who they believe are the top 8 teams in their sport. The votes are then added up and the following are the results from those votes.

Softball

  1. Clackamas CC – 8-0 league, 21-6 overall – prev. 3rd
  2. Lower Columbia College – 6-2 league, 26-3 overall – prev. 1st
  3. Mt. Hood CC – 5-3 league, 20-6 overall – prev. 2nd
  4. Wenatchee Valley College – 15-3 league, 29-6 overall – prev. 4th
  5. Southwestern Oregon CC – 3-5 league, 23-5 overall – prev. 5th
  6. Walla Walla CC – 11-7 league, 20-15 overall – prev. 7th
  7. Bellevue College – 8-4 league, 20-9 overall – prev. 6th
  8. Shoreline CC – 9-1 league, 14-8 overall – prev. 8th
    Others receiving votes: Columbia Basin College, CC’s of Spokane, Chemeketa CC, Pierce College, Olympic College

Baseball – (3 of the top 8 are from the Northern Region – BC, EvCC, EdCC)

  1. Lower Columbia College – 10-3 league, 24-4 overall – prev. 2nd
  2. Columbia Basin College – 13-3 league, 24-8 overall – prev. 1st
  3. Bellevue College – 11-5 league, 23-13 overall – prev. 3rd
  4. Mt. Hood CC – 10-4 league, 17-11 overall – prev. 6th
  5. EVERETT CC – 9-3 league, 18-10 overall – prev. Not Ranked
  6. Yakima Valley CC – 13-3 league, 25-8 overall – prev. Not Ranked
  7. Edmonds CC – 8-4 league, 21-8 overall – prev. 7th
  8. Green River CC – 8-6 league, 15-11 overall – prev. 8th
    Others receiving votes: Tacoma CC, Treasure Valley CC, Skagit Valley College, Clackamas CC
